Definition
English
:
The major active component of
silymarin
flavonoids
extracted from seeds of the
MILK THISTLE
, Silybum marianum; it is used in the treatment of
HEPATITIS
;
LIVER CIRRHOSIS
; and
CHEMICAL AND DRUG INDUCED LIVER INJURY
, and has antineoplastic activity; silybins A and B are diastereomers.
